WebDec 14, 2024 · There is not exactly a fixed rule as when to use disks and when to use washers. Generally, whey y is expressed as a function of x. (which is most common) And you are rotating around the x axis, use disks/ washers. And when rotating around the y axis use shells. But often it can be done both ways just as easily. WebYou use the disk/washer method when the axis you're rotating across is parallel to the axis you're integrating on. skullturf • 6 yr. ago And if OP wants to understand why this is true, I strongly recommend drawing a typical slice of the region, and the axis we're rotating around, and seeing whether the shape thus formed is a disk or a washer. WebMar 4, 2024 · The washer method is a way to find the volume of objects of revolution. It’s a modification of the disc method for solid objects to allow for objects with holes. It’s called the “washer method” because the cross sections look like washers. A thin, horizontal …
